## Local Setup

The Marlowe orders service uses soft deletes: rows in the orders table get a deleted_at timestamp instead of being removed. All queries in the repo layer filter these out automatically, so don't query the table directly without that predicate. To run migrations locally, point your client at the dev database using the connection string below.

primary connection of yagep-kahip = redis://giliel_svc:zYiKsLL2PLpfPL@db-348f.xolmarsys.corp:5432/fenwyn

**Runbook: Query planner regression after the Fernwheel 4.2 upgrade**

If dashboards start crawling right after an upgrade, check whether the planner stopped picking the covering index on the events table — we've seen it fall back to sequential scans when stats are stale. Quick fix: re-run the analyzer job on the three biggest tables, then bounce the query cache. If that doesn't help, flip the legacy-planner flag and file a ticket rather than tinkering further. The first build known to exhibit this regression is recorded below.

session token of fawep-tajep = htk14_4221f8eaf43a2f

Subject: Loading dock hours — read before arrival

Contractors: the Marwick Row loading dock accepts deliveries 06:30–11:00 weekdays only. No afternoon slots. Book your bay with the front desk at least one day ahead. Vehicles left after 11:15 will be moved. Reverse in, engines off while unloading. To raise the dock shutter on arrival, enter the code below.

turnstile pass: bdg-NG-3

- [ ] **Step 7: Breaker override escrow.** After sealing the signing keys for the Tallgrove upstream API circuit breaker, confirm the support team can force the breaker open during a full outage. The override bundle lives in the sealed escrow drawer and is useless without its unlock phrase. Two ceremony witnesses must initial this step before proceeding. The escrow bundle is decrypted with the recovery passphrase that follows.

vault phrase of kahip-kahop = holath-quenmir